Historically the U-boat personnel was part of the Kriegsmarine, the German Navy. They did not have a direct connection with the National Socialist party. In fact, because the U-boat men were isolated, the Nazis wanted to make sure that they were still properly indoctrinated and sometimes sent Nazi agents on missions to rat people who talked badly about the party. If anything, the Nazis were a menace to their own military too, which could be an interesting gameplay twist, having to deal with the stress added on the crew by the presence of a Nazi agent on board.

It’s an interesting historical aspect of the war and I don’t plan to shy on it. I believe that the only legal restriction is the display of the swastika in certain countries, but I have no reason to  show any so I don’t think this will be an issue.
